Technical Details for CVE-2025-37942

Vulnerability Analysis

CVE-2025-37942 has been rejected by its CVE Numbering Authority. When a CVE is rejected, it typically means one of the following scenarios occurred:

  • The reported issue was determined not to be a security vulnerability
  • The vulnerability was a duplicate of an existing CVE
  • The report contained insufficient information to validate the issue
  • The affected vendor disputed the vulnerability claim
  • The CVE was assigned in error

Organizations should remove this CVE from their vulnerability tracking systems and consult the CVE Numbering Authority for any replacement CVE if one was issued.
